A projectile is projected in the upward direction making an angle of `60^(@)` with the horizontal direction with a velocity of `147 ms^(-1)`. After what time will its inclination with the horizontal be `45^(@)` ?

Text Solution

Verified by Experts

The correct Answer is:
`(5.49 s)`
